2016-10-02 78 views
0

我目前正試圖弄清楚如何做數學,當涉及到簽名的數字。我有點理解二補的概念,但知道如何充分使用它是令我困惑的。混淆說到兩個的補充

這是我目前正在處理的問題:

1100.1111.1110-0011.1111-1010-1100.1101.1100 

我所做的就是找到每個數字的二進制補碼,然後加在一起。

1100.1111.1110 -> 0011.0000.0010 
0011.1111 -> 1100.0001 
1010.1100.1101.1100 -> 0101.0011.0010.0100 

加在一起後,我得到了:

0101.0110.1110.0111 

我有我搞砸這件事的感覺,我只是擔心,我沒有比我想象更糟糕。

回答

0

只取負數的2的補數,然後用正數加上它們。

一件事,U [R如何得到0011.0000.1111爲2的的1100.1111.1110補充,
它應該是0011.0000.0010 & NBSP要不我沒有得到你的二進制表示。

+0

謝謝你指出錯字。我修好了它。 – Frog6666